CS301 Introduction to Python

This course introduces an easy-to learn, high-level computer language that is used in many of applications. Students will gain a comprehensive and in-depth understanding of the Python language through hand-on exercises. Topics include Python basics, lists, dictionaries, sets, file operations, functions, modules, classes and object-oriented programming.

Credits

3

Prerequisite

CS117